Village Overview

Iswaripur is a village in Chakdah Block, also recorded as a Census sub-district, Nadia district, West Bengal. For Iswaripur, the population is 1,511, PIN code is 741245 and Census village code is 322195. Location and Administration

Iswaripur comes under Iswaripur gram panchayat and Chakdah C.D. Block. Its local administrative unit is Chakdah Block, also recorded as a Census sub-district. The block headquarters is Chakdah at 13.50 km. The Census district headquarters, Krishnanagar, is 52.30 km away.

Population Profile

The population details below are from Census 2011 village records. They help you understand the size of Iswaripur village and its household count.

Total population

1,511 residents in 368 households

Male population

766

Female population

745

SC/ST population

Scheduled Castes: 1,038; Scheduled Tribes: 2
